Patriot announced this week a new SSD with the PCIe 4 interface, the P400 V4. The drive comes in M.2 format and promises speeds of up to 6,200MB/s for reading and up to 5,200MB/s for writing. The new SSD also offers several storage options for different uses.
With the year 2025 just around the corner, SSDs using the PCIe 5.0 interface should become increasingly common, but Patriot shows that options will still appear with the previous generation of the platform. In addition to being much more popular on mainstream PCs, it is the format adopted by current consoles.
It’s no surprise that Patriot promotes its new P400 V4 for use on the PS5 as well. The company says its “advanced graphene heatshield” helps maintain stable performance on the console. However, the manufacturer itself points out that on the PS5 the reading speed is a little slower, reaching 6,000MB/s.
Unfortunately, Patriot did not offer an official price list for its new SSDs. The company, however, confirmed that they will be launched in capacities of 500GB, 1TB, 2TB and 4TB.
Patriot P400 V4 detailed speeds
It is worth mentioning that performance rates vary depending on the capacity of each model. Below are the estimates for each option of the new Patriot SSD:
- 500GB: Reading up to 5,000MB/s | Recording up to 3,000MB/s (160TB TBW)
- 1TB: Reading up to 6,000MB/s | Recording up to 5,000MB/s (320TB TBW)
- 2TB: Reading up to 6,200MB/s | Recording up to 5,200MB/s (640TB TBW)
- 4TB: Reading up to 6,200MB/s | Recording up to 5,200MB/s (1280TB TBW)
The P400 V4 drives feature SmartECC technology and support even older versions of Windows, such as 7 and 8, as long as the user searches for the correct drivers. They are certified to work between temperatures of 0ºC and 70ºC and the company also promises a 5-year warranty for the products.
